Ultimate Comfort Food: Bacon Mac and Cheese

There’s nothing quite like a heaping serving of warm, gooey mac and cheese, enhanced with the savory crunch of bacon. It’s the perfect dish to satisfy your comfort food cravings, and it’s surprisingly easy to make from scratch. Get your taste buds ready for a creamy, cheesy adventure with a salty, smoky twist.

Ingredients:

  • 400g elbow macaroni
  • 6 strips of thick-cut bacon
  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ups milk
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• 2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ese
  • 1 cup shredded Gruyere cheese
  • 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  • 2 t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the macaroni and cook until just al dente, about 8 minutes. Drain well and set aside.
  3. In a large skillet, cook the bacon over medium heat until crisp. Transfer to a paper towel-lined plate, crumble when cool, and set aside.
  4. In a large sa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Whisk in the flour and cook for about 1 minute, stirring constantly to create a roux.
  5. Gradually whisk in the milk and heavy cream, ensuring there are no lumps. Continue to stir as the mixture thickens, about 5 minutes.
  6. Add the shredded cheddar and Gruyere cheese to the saucepan, stirring until the cheese has completely melted and the sauce is smooth.
  7. Stir in the smoked paprika,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
  8. Add the cooked macaroni to the cheese sauce, mixing well until evenly coated.
  9. Fold in the crumbled bacon, reserving some for topping.
  10. Transfer the mac and cheese to a greased baking dish.
  11. In a small bowl, mix together the bre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, and the remaining crumbled bacon. Sprinkle this mixture over the mac and cheese.
  12. Bake in the preheated oven for 20 to 25 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and bubbling.
  13. Remove from oven and let it sit for 5 minutes before serving.
  14. Garnish with fresh parsley and serve hot.

Pro Tips:

  • For an extra creamy texture, you can add an extra splash of milk or cream to the cheese sauce if it seems too thick.
  • Feel free to experiment with different types of cheese to find the perfect blend that suits your taste.
  • Adding a pinch of nutmeg to the cheese sauce can bring out a unique, nutty flavor.
